Straits Trading's H1 Loss Narrows; Revenue Jumps
MT Newswires08-17 19:18
The Straits Trading Company (SGX:S20) logged a net loss attributable to owners of SG$11.1 million for the first half compared with a loss of SG$40.8 million a year ago.
The investment holding company, with operations in resources, real estate, and hospitality, recorded a loss per share of SG$0.024 compared with SG$0.09 a year earlier, a Singapore Exchange filing on Monday showed.
For the six months ended June, revenue was SG$400 million, up 50% from SG$267.5 million a year ago.
